Silk Mills P&R to remain closed amid 'unauthorised encampment'

Bosses at Somerset Council have confirmed the Silk Mills Park and Ride will remain closed today and tomorrow (March 28 and 29) amid an 'unauthorised encampment' being set up earlier this week.

Somerset Council say the service will operate as usual between Taunton Gateway, the town centre and Musgrove Park Hospital.

In a statement sent to us on Wednesday, bosses at Somerset Council said: "Bus services to the Silk Mills Park and Ride have been temporarily suspended following an unauthorised encampment.

"Anyone with a vehicle parked at the site will be dropped at the gates and can collect their vehicles this evening.

"Service 1E will also be suspended from entering the site this evening until further notice.

"From tomorrow morning 27 March the park and ride service will remain suspended until the situation is resolved. Security staff are on site and a legal process underway.

"The service will operate as usual between Taunton Gateway, town centre and Musgrove Park Hospital, terminating in Mountway Road.

"The Gateway Park and Ride at junction 25 will be operating as normal."
